Setting Up Unary Alarms 
To set up unary alarms:
1. Press Unary. The unary alarm 
Select screen appears.
2. Press ▼ and ▲ to scroll 
through the list of unary alarms.
3. Press Edit to select an alarm to 
be configured.
4. Press Edit to select Enable.
5. Press + and - to scroll between 
Yes and No.
6. Press OK to enable or disable 
the alarm.
7. Press 
▼ to select Priority.
8. Press + and - to scroll through 
priority options Low, None, 
High, or Medium.
NOTE: See “Alarm Priorities” 
on page 66 for more 
information.
9. Press OK to set the priority.
10. Press 
▼ to select Select 
Digital Output, then press Edit.
NOTE: The digital output 
behavior mode must be Timed 
or Coil Hold to turn on when a 
unary alarm event occurs.
11. Press + and - to scroll through 
the list of digital outputs to 
associate with the alarm.
12. Press OK to select a digital 
output to be associated with the 
selected alarm.
13. If the selected digital output 
already has an association that 
will be lost by making the new 
selection, a confirmation 
screen appears. 
— Press Yes to accept the 
changes and return to the 
previous screen.
— Press No to keep the 
existing configuration in use 
and return to the previous 
screen.
14. Press 
▲ to save all alarms 
selections and return to the 
previous screen.
15. Press 
▲ to save all unary 
alarm selections.
